Luxury Nara Sake Brewery & Michelin Tour Journey Deep into Japan’s Sake Culture with a Sake Master
Discover the ancient culture, exceptional cuisine and world-class sake of Nara on an exclusive 8-day journey with Insider Sake Tours Japan.
Known for its famous deer and Great Buddha, Nara is also the birthplace of refined sake. Follow the region’s centuries-old brewing traditions, from the origins of sake at Shoryaku-ji Temple to innovative and sustainable breweries today.
Hosted by Sake Samurai Simone Maynard, this immersive journey offers rare access to master brewers, historic breweries and sacred sites rarely experienced by visitors.
